champlevé

Syllabification: (champ·le·vé)
Pronunciation: /ˌSHäNləˈvā/

Definition of champlevé

noun

  • enamelwork in which hollows made in a metal surface are filled with colored enamel.

Origin:

French, from champ 'field' + levé 'raised'
